About this home
With Timber Framed beams, stress skin panel walls and radiant heat, you will find this home to be very energy efficient. Open living room, kitchen and dining with open center stair case allows for a warm bright space for living. The living room opens out to the back deck overlooking the Vermont forest. Lower level offers an en suite bedroom which the current owners have successfully rented as an AirBnB. Two bedrooms, full bath, reading den and a sleeping loft are on the 3rd level. Enjoy the Vermont outdoors, with simple perennial garden or have your own veggie garden in the back yard. The home is located just a short drive to Brattleboro as well as to skiing at Mount Snow.

RU
Rural District
The purpose of the Rural District is to accommodate low to moderate density development that is consistent with existing land uses and sensitive to the limitations of the land and existing land uses. Limited commercial uses are allowed in a manner that avoids unreasonable burdens on town roads and services or other adverse impacts on the rural character of the district.
